Death toll rises to 8 in mine collapse in Russia's Far East

MOSCOW, May 4 (Xinhua) -- Eight people have been confirmed dead after a coal mine collapse in Russia's Magadan region in the Far East, local authorities said Monday.

Magadan Region Governor Sergey Nosov said that four additional bodies were recovered during debris clearance at the Kadykchansky coal mine, bringing the death toll to eight.

The rescue operation lasted for days, clearing more than 15,500 cubic meters of rock, Nosov said.

The collapse occurred on Thursday, trapping eight workers. Rescuers had recovered four bodies from the rubble by Sunday, Russia's Emergency Situations Ministry said.
